TTS Taps New Medical Director, Las Vegas Branch Manager

MIAMI — Talent Testing Service announced several personnel moves today.

The testing service for adult performers tapped a new company medical director and named a new branch manager for its Las Vegas office.

Dr. Jason Dazley was appointed the testing services new medical director, according to Sixto Pacheco, TTS president and CEO. Dazley is a New Providence, N.J.-based internal medicine specialist.

“We are excited to have Dr. Dazley on board,” Pacheco said. “Dr. Dazley’s many years of experience in infectious diseases will be an asset to TTS, its customers and the adult industry in general.” 

Maria Yanez, who worked at TTS’ Northridge office for three years, was chosen as branch manager at its Las Vegas office, he said.

“This is a welcomed change to all our customers in Las Vegas,” he said. “We are confident Maria will bring much needed energy and spunk to that office”  

TTS is a privately held company with headquarters in Miami and offices in Los Angeles, Oakland and Las Vegas.
